What is an overload offense?
The basic concept of the overload offense is to bring all five players to one side of the floor and effectively outnumber the defensive players on the overloaded side of the zone.

What is the 2-3 Zone’s Real Weakness?
- The Zone doesn’t defend the three-point shot.
- The Zone gives up too many offensive rebounds.
- The Zone doesn’t defend the high post.
What is the best offense against a 2-3 zone?
The 1-3-1 is the best formation to set up in offensively against a 2-3 zone. Traditionally, this will mean your point guard at the top, your shooting guard and small forward on the wings, one big on the free-throw line, and one big on the baseline.
Can you play zone defense in NBA?
Zone defenses are common in international, college, and youth competition. The NBA has a defensive three-second violation rule, which makes it more difficult for teams to play zone, since such defenses usually position a player in the middle of the key to stop penetration.

How do you coach a 2-3 zone defense?
Rebounding must be a constant emphasis when coaching a 2-3 zone defense. Since your players are guarding an area and don’t all have specific players, your team is at a distinct disadvantage compared to a man-to-man each time a shot is put up.
What is the corner trap in a 2-3 zone defense?
The corner trap in a 2-3 zone defense is by far the most effective trap you can use in a 2-3 zone. The offensive player with the ball is forced to make a very long and high pass in order to get the ball to a teammate if the trap is performed correctly. How do you use a 2-3 zone in basketball?
For example, if you do have a big and slow team, the most effective way to use a 2-3 zone may be to play a patiently, limit trapping, and force the offense to move the ball around until they can find a gap or an open shot.
